The French sent the Italian home after an 84-75 victory in the quarterfinals with Gobert taking point in scoring. The 29-year-old put up 22 points and 9 rebounds to help his team take the game. Evan Fournier is right behind Gobert with 21 points, 3 rebounds, and 4 assists.

Although he wasn’t the best shooter on the court with 7 of 18 shots made and 3 of 9 from beyond the arc, he did enough to make sure that they stayed in the game. The last two double-digit scorers in the team were Nicolas Batum and Thomas Heurtel with 15 points and 10 points, respectively.

This is France’s first time in the semifinals of the Olympics in over two decades. When they face team Slovenia on Thursday, they have to make sure that Luka Doncic stays in their sights. There’s no sign of stopping the young forward, and Gobert’s services in the pain will be more crucial than ever. But when it comes to depth and efficiency, France gets the edge in this game. Team Slovenia made light work of their opponents as they punched a ticket to the semifinals. They completed a relatively easy win against Germany in a 94-70 victory with Zoran Dragic draining 27 points on an incredible 11 of 13 shooting from the field. Of course, Doncic delivered proper numbers with 20 points, 11 assists, and 2 rebounds short of completing a triple-double.

While the Germans held on up until the second quarter, the Slovenians started to pick up more pace in the second half of the game. Center Mike Tobey contributed 13 points and dominated the boards with 11 rebounds. We look forward to Doncic and Jaka Blazic controlling the backcourt for Slovenia, while Vlatko Cancar and Zoran Dragic run the frontcourt and Tobey holds the center position.

This game against France is expected to put the team in front of a tougher test. They take on one of the toughest teams in the Olympics and will require everyone to step up. But with plenty of momentum and confidence driving the team, this game might be closer than expected.
